The Importance Of Pharmaceutical Supplies In The UK

In the United Kingdom, the pharmaceutical industry plays a crucial role in ensuring the health and well-being of the population Pharmaceutical supplies in the UK are essential for providing the necessary medications and treatments to a wide range of medical conditions From hospitals and pharmacies to clinics and research facilities, pharmaceutical supplies are vital in the healthcare system.

Pharmaceutical supplies encompass a wide variety of products, including medications, vaccines, medical devices, and equipment These supplies are regulated by strict guidelines and quality standards to ensure the safety and efficacy of the products The pharmaceutical industry in the UK is highly regulated by government agencies such as the Medicines and Healthcare products Regulatory Agency (MHRA) to ensure that all pharmaceutical supplies meet the required standards.

The UK pharmaceutical industry is a major contributor to the economy, generating billions of pounds in revenue and creating thousands of jobs The industry is also a key player in medical research and innovation, developing new medications and treatments to address a range of health issues Pharmaceutical supplies in the UK are essential for supporting the healthcare system and ensuring that patients have access to the medications they need.

One of the key factors driving the demand for pharmaceutical supplies in the UK is the aging population As people live longer, the prevalence of chronic diseases and conditions such as diabetes, cardiovascular disease, and cancer is on the rise This has resulted in an increased need for medications and treatments to manage these conditions and improve the quality of life for patients.

In addition to providing essential medications for the treatment of various medical conditions, pharmaceutical supplies in the UK also play a crucial role in preventing the spread of infectious diseases Vaccines are a vital part of the healthcare system, helping to protect the population from illnesses such as influenza, measles, and COVID-19 The availability of vaccines and other pharmaceutical supplies is essential for maintaining public health and preventing outbreaks of disease.

This supply chain ensures that medications and other products are available when and where they are needed, ensuring that patients receive the care they require Pharmaceutical supplies are also subject to strict regulations regarding storage, transportation, and handling to maintain their quality and efficacy.

The COVID-19 pandemic has highlighted the importance of pharmaceutical supplies in the UK, with the healthcare system facing unprecedented challenges in providing care to patients The demand for medications, medical devices, and equipment surged as hospitals and healthcare providers struggled to cope with the influx of COVID-19 patients Pharmaceutical supplies played a critical role in supporting the healthcare system and ensuring that patients received the care they needed.

The pharmaceutical industry in the UK has responded to the challenges posed by the pandemic by ramping up production of essential medications and supplies Manufacturers have worked around the clock to ensure that medications are available to patients, while researchers have developed new treatments and vaccines to combat COVID-19 Pharmaceutical supplies have been a key factor in the UK’s response to the pandemic, helping to minimize the impact of the virus on the population.
